Our 3-Layer Safety Architecture
Chemical Tempering (Ion Exchange)
Potassium-ion exchange bath creates a compressive stress layer (CS ≥ 700 MPa, DOL 20-50 µm). Unlike thermal tempering, this process works on glass as thin as 0.55mm without optical distortion -- critical for precision touch sensors.
Anti-Shatter PET Film Lamination
Optically clear adhesive (OCA) bonding of 100-200 µm anti-shatter PET film. Fragments are retained on the film upon impact, preventing secondary injuries. Haze ≤ 1.5%, light transmittance ≥ 91%.
Precision CNC Edge Forming & Stress Relief
CNC diamond-wheel grinding with chamfered or C-edge profiles eliminates micro-cracks at cut edges -- the #1 failure initiation point in field returns. Post-process stress measurement via polariscope is standard.
Technical Specifications
Full parameter transparency. Every spec below is measurable, testable, and documented in our outgoing QC report.
Glass Substrate
| Material Options | Corning® Gorilla, AGC Dragontrail, Soda-Lime |
| Thickness Range | 0.55 - 6.0 mm |
| Max. Panel Size | 1200 × 900 mm |
| Dimensional Tolerance | ± 0.05 mm |
| Flatness | ≤ 0.1 mm / 100 mm |
Tempering Performance
| Process Type | Chemical (Ion Exchange) |
| Compressive Stress (CS) | ≥ 700 MPa |
| Depth of Layer (DOL) | 20 - 50 µm |
| Pencil Hardness | ≥ 7H |
| Bending Strength | ≥ 400 MPa |
Optical Properties
| Light Transmittance | ≥ 91% |
| Haze (with film) | ≤ 1.5% |
| Reflectance (AR coated) | ≤ 0.5% per surface |
| Surface Roughness (Ra) | ≤ 0.5 nm |
| Refractive Index | 1.50 - 1.52 @ 589nm |
Safety & Impact
| Drop Test (500g steel ball) | ≥ 1.2 m (no penetration) |
| Fragment Retention | 100% (PET film) |
| Thermal Shock Resistance | -40°C ↔ +85°C (200 cycles) |
| Compliance Standards | IEC 62368, EN 12150 |
| Edge Treatment | C-edge / Flat / Custom |

Patient-Facing Display Covers & Diagnostic Screens
In patient monitors, infusion pumps, and point-of-care diagnostic devices, a shattered display creates immediate contamination and injury risks. Our chemically tempered safety glass with PET film lamination meets IEC 62368-1 clause 5.6 (mechanical strength) and is compatible with IP65 sealing requirements.
- Biocompatible coatings available (ISO 10993 guidance)
- Chemical resistance to hospital-grade disinfectants
- Cleanroom-assembled to ISO Class 7
